Teach your students to be responsible and complement your classroom management routine with this Editable Classroom Helper System. These classroom jobs help your students build leadership skills as they complete jobs in the classroom by being helpers. This classroom job resource includes a variety of posters, activities, tools, and ways to set up to help you develop a well-rounded job routine.

Use this resource in your classroom management system to teach responsibility. It allows your students to pick and choose which jobs they would like to do, write about why they would be the best fit for the position, and learn how to complete a job with the included job checklists.

The best part? This resource saves you time as the job boards are easy to set up. This resource includes everything you’d need to set up a leadership system! Create a bulletin board display, set up in a pocket chart, or use library pockets wherever you have space to get your new job chart up and running.
